What Is Julaine?

Julaine is a PLLA (Poly-L-Lactic Acid) biostimulator designed to restore facial volume, improve skin texture and boost collagen production. Unlike traditional fillers, it works gradually, enhancing firmness and elasticity over time for a naturally youthful, lifted appearance.

Julaine is formulated with Poly-L-Lactic Acid, a biocompatible material used in aesthetic medicine for its ability to stimulate the body's own collagen production. Rather than physically filling space beneath the skin as a dermal filler does, Julaine triggers a gradual biological response, so improvements in firmness and texture build steadily over the weeks and months following treatment.

Julaine is generally well suited to those noticing a gradual loss of facial firmness, a softening of the skin's texture, or reduced volume, who would like to address this without the more immediate, sculpted look that fillers can produce. Because results build steadily over a series of sessions, it also suits patients who prefer a subtler, more conservative approach to facial rejuvenation.

Dermal fillers add volume immediately by physically filling space beneath the skin. Julaine works differently: it stimulates your own collagen production over time, so results build gradually rather than appearing instantly.

Because Julaine works by stimulating collagen production, most patients benefit from a short course of sessions rather than a single visit. Your Aesthetic Doctor will recommend a schedule based on your skin and goals during consultation.

Results with Julaine develop gradually as your body's own collagen production increases, rather than appearing immediately after treatment. Your practitioner will talk you through a realistic timeline at your consultation.
